www.diariocritico.com

Python. ¿Para qué sirve? ¿Por qué aprenderlo?

Python. ¿Para qué sirve? ¿Por qué aprenderlo?
Ampliar
miércoles 24 de noviembre de 2021, 23:38h

El otro día mi amigo ‘Valentín’ me preguntó si él podría convertirse en programador de Python. Que su única experiencia había sido aprender a ‘programar’ la lavadora para que arrancara a las 6 de la mañana de forma automática para ahorrarse unos eurillos con la luz.

Mi respuesta fue que, si de verdad quería convertirse en un programador en Python, no necesitaba más. Para aprender a programar no es necesario tener una inteligencia superior, lo único necesario es que te guste y tengas ganas de jugar y de sentirte como un niño cuando creas tu primera ventanita e interactúas con el programa que has creado.

Todos pueden programar, es fácil y divertido, sólo hay que ponerle ganas, animarse. Cualquiera puede aprender. Programar es como tocar un instrumento o practicar un deporte. Al principio puede parecer intimidante o difícil, pero con el tiempo y la práctica se convierte en una actividad muy gratificante.

Ernest W. Adams, uno de los hackers más conocidos de Estados Unidos, decía que la programación de computadoras era “algo así como jugar a ser Dios”.

Python se utiliza hoy día para multitud de actividades como aplicaciones web, automatización de operaciones, ciencia de datos, inteligencia artificial, etc. En mi caso lo utilizo para mi actividad de ‘trader’, para optimizar mis estrategias de trading e inversión, para investigar nuevas ideas y para automatizar dichos procesos.

Además, Python es un lenguaje de programación interpretado y de fácil lectura, gratuito y respaldado por una comunidad de usuarios enorme que no para de crecer y de aportar multitud de soluciones y librerías que hacen mucho más fácil cualquier tarea que queramos desarrollar.

Puedes buscar todas las definiciones de programación que quieras en internet, y a la tercera que encuentres, probablemente ya te entren ganas de dedicarte a otra cosa porque no entiendas ni la mitad de lo que significan. Pero para mí, la programación es simplemente el lenguaje con el que nos comunicamos con una máquina, a la que le decimos principalmente que, si ocurre esto, haga esto, y si ocurre lo otro, haga lo otro, además de repetirlo tantas veces como queramos.

Aprender a programar te permitirá explotar tus habilidades creativas y fortalecer tu capacidad analítica. Jobs decía que “…te enseña a pensar”. Podemos decir que programar es como una herramienta de pensamiento que fomenta tu propio desarrollo intelectual e imaginativo. Te enseña a pensar de otro modo. Te enseña cómo puedes descomponer un problema complejo en problemas más sencillos y resolverlos más fácilmente.

El filósofo (recientemente fallecido) Antonio Escohotado siempre decía que uno de los principales valores del ser humano es “la curiosidad y el amor al saber”.

Aprender a programar te dará la posibilidad de generar proyectos propios y originales. Tus propias ideas te motivarán a crear cosas nuevas. Y como en cualquier área, el aprendizaje es más fácil y más sostenible si se enfoca de forma práctica y orientado a una temática de nuestro interés.

Desde viviendodeltrading.com intentamos seguir esa filosofía y todas nuestras formaciones son totalmente prácticas, enfocadas a resultados y proyectos concretos. Intentamos centrarnos en lo realmente importante y que más se usa. Eliminando la paja y las demostraciones teóricas. A la mayoría de alumnos les interesa más comprobar que algo funciona, que demostrar por qué funciona.

Desde el primer día colocamos al alumno en el comienzo del camino y le ayudamos a dar el primer paso. Estamos a su lado y le acompañamos en todo el trayecto, paso a paso, indicándole la mejor forma de llegar al final y corrigiendo aquello que lo pueda desviar de sus objetivos. Una vez llegado a la meta, el mundo y las posibilidades que se abren son infinitas para cada uno.

En nuestro caso nos centramos en el área de finanzas, trading e inversiones. Una de nuestras pasiones. En este sector, el análisis de datos, series temporales, selección de subyacentes es muy importante, y con la programación lo podemos explotar al máximo.

Saber programación, crear tus propios proyectos, ideas, etc., te dará la oportunidad de tomar tus propias decisiones, de comprobar si son ciertas determinadas recomendaciones, si realmente funcionan o son ciertas esas estrategias que te están intentando vender.

En los 7 Capítulos sobre la aplicación práctica de Python habrás podido comprobar cómo hemos analizado la estrategia DCA y Buy the Dip, con unos resultados sorprendentes para más de uno.

Si te interesa todo este tema de programación y finanzas tienes la oportunidad de aprender ambas cosas con nosotros. No sólo te enseñamos a programar en Python, sino que te introducimos en el mundo de las Carteras Pasivas para que además aproveches de forma práctica dichos conocimientos.

Hoy, 25 de noviembre de 2021 a las 20:30 estaremos en directo en un webinar gratuito con información sobre el próximo programa formativo de Python. Puedes registrarte y asistir en directo y preguntar las dudas o cuestiones que te surjan.

¿Te ha parecido interesante esta noticia?    Si (0)    No(0)

+

0 comentarios